Output 83db3dd3da7b9cd4aef96f2b2830a101679a989a75d9191f7938dbdda949bdc2:45

value
8388608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 57c4eed24dacb56e3907c5073117c02f91d8fc180cda3fdc4a7b89effb4c0ff9
address
bc1p2lzwa5jd4j6kuwg8c5rnz97q97ga3lqcpndrlhz20wy7l76vplusk9pqr0
transaction
83db3dd3da7b9cd4aef96f2b2830a101679a989a75d9191f7938dbdda949bdc2
confirmations
16404
spent
true